Lot's of flooding in SE MI. We crossed over Hines Drive earlier today. For those that don't know it runs along the Rouge River through several cities with park land on both sides of the road. It's a natural flood plane so the road is often closed when we get a lot of rain. Today you wouldn't even know there is road down there. Couldn't see any of the parking areas or baseball fields. Kid's play structures were almost completely submersed and picnic tables floating in the water. Never seen that much water there before.
